Members

Members

The Members page is the main entry point for managing your club's roster. It gives you a bird's-eye view of every member, their membership status, attendance trends, and current belt rank -- all from a single, searchable list.

Members list page showing statistics, filters, and member table
The members list with statistics panel, filters, and sortable table.

Statistics panel

At the top of the members list, four key metrics give you a quick health check of your club:

  • Active Members -- The total number of members with at least one active membership. The subtext shows how many new members joined this month.
  • Lost Members -- Members whose memberships were cancelled in the last 30 days. Use this to spot unusual churn.
  • At-Risk Members -- Active members who have not attended a single class in the last 30 days. These members may be losing motivation and could benefit from a personal check-in.
  • Prospects -- The number of leads with a "new" status, representing people who have expressed interest but have not yet signed up.

Searching and filtering

The search bar lets you find members by name or email. Results update as you type. When a search query is active, column sorting is temporarily disabled because results are ranked by relevance.

Filters

Three filter menus sit above the table:

  • Discipline -- If your club teaches more than one discipline (for example, Brazilian Jiu-Jitsu and Muay Thai), this filter shows only members enrolled in the selected discipline. The filter is hidden when the club has a single discipline.
  • Demographic -- Filter by user demographic such as "Adults", "Kids", or "Teens". This corresponds to the demographic assigned to each plan. Hidden when only one demographic exists.
  • Status -- The most detailed filter, split into two sections:

Membership status filters

These match the actual membership statuses stored in the system:

  • Active -- Members with a currently active membership.
  • Paused -- Members whose membership is temporarily paused.
  • New -- Members created but who have not started onboarding yet.
  • Onboarding started -- Members who opened the onboarding flow but did not complete it.
  • Cancelled -- Members whose memberships have all been cancelled.
  • Defaulted -- Members who have defaulted on payments.

Special filters

  • At risk -- Active members with zero class attendance in the last 30 days.
  • Inactive -- Members who either have no memberships at all, or whose memberships are all cancelled.
  • Membership ending -- Members with a scheduled cancellation date approaching within the next two billing periods.
  • Contract term ending -- Members whose initial contract commitment is ending within the next two billing periods, but who have not yet cancelled. These members are about to become month-to-month.
  • Monthly cancellable -- Members whose contract period has already passed and who can now cancel on a monthly basis.

Default view

By default, the list shows all members except those with only cancelled memberships. This keeps cancelled members out of the way while still showing members without a membership (such as newly created members who have not been assigned a plan yet).


The members table

Each row in the table shows:

  • Member -- Name, age (if date of birth is set), email, online status, and profile picture. Tags and a "trainer" badge appear next to the name when applicable. If the member is a minor, the responsible guardian's name and email are displayed below. An attendance heatmap spanning the last three months appears at the bottom of the cell, with green squares indicating training weeks.
  • Membership -- The active plan name, demographic, and price. Below the plan name you see the membership start date and either the contract end date or a "monthly cancellable" label. If a cancellation is scheduled, the end date appears in red.
  • Status -- A color-coded pill showing the membership status (active, paused, cancelled, etc.).
  • Graduation -- When the graduation feature is enabled, the current belt and stripe count for each discipline is shown. This column is hidden if the club does not use graduations.
  • Discipline -- Shown only when the club has more than one discipline.

Sorting

You can sort by member name, membership start date, or status by clicking on the column headers. Sorting toggles between ascending and descending order. Sorting is disabled while a search query is active.

Missing payment method warning

A red credit card icon appears next to a member's name when they have an active membership but no payment method on file. For minor members, this check extends to their responsible guardian. Clicking the icon takes you directly to the payment methods page.


Quick view

Clicking the three-dot menu on any row opens the Quick View drawer on the right side of the screen. This gives you a summary of the member without leaving the list, including their personal details, membership info, and quick actions.


Adding a new member

Click the Add Member button in the top-right corner to open the member creation wizard. The wizard guides you through providing the member's personal details, selecting a plan, and setting up their membership. Sign-up fees associated with the plan are listed during the wizard, and a checkbox lets you skip those charges if needed.

Permission required

Only users with the "manage members" permission can add or modify members. If the button is not visible, check your role assignments.


Exporting members

When the members export feature is enabled in your settings, an Export button appears next to the Add Member button. Clicking it downloads an Excel file containing your full member roster. The export includes all members matching your current filters.

Previous
Analytics